Connection Instructions Grounding Ensure that you connect the grounding / earth wire to prevent possible electric shock. If grounding methods are not possible, have a qualified electrician install a separate circuit breaker. Do not try to ground the unit by connecting it to telephone wires, lightening rods, or gas pipes. To improve picture quality in a poor ANT IN signal area, purchase and install a signal amplifier. If the antenna needs to be split for two TV s, install a 2-Way Signal Splitter in the connections. If the antenna is not installed properly, contact your dealer for assistance. NOTE: All cables shown are just for example.
